    I used it for several months and I loved it. Once you setup all rules, you can even disable the GUI and keep just service, no po-pups and zero performance impact, the service takes like 0,00% CPU. and 5MB RAM. If you install the new software, just enable GUI to get the rules. The only problem is, that the free version has all Windows processes allowed. I trialed the paid versions, but you need at least Plus to get some control, but creating rules gets way too complicated there.

    It doesn't check, if you are at least in medium filtering, and didn't add an allow rule for WFC.

    Dev states they don't collect personal data, and they just use it to monitor the number of people using WFC, to be able to decide what they (MB) do with their aquisition...
    Still, maybe it is like this now, but in the future we never know. We all know the story and how big companies can abuse privacy.
    I think they just need to put a telemetry "opt-out" option...Stating what they collect and why, being transparent.
    It should be mandatory by law even (maybe it is, in Europe?)
